Important Considerations for a Nighttime BBQ in Ruian:
Safety First: Always prioritize safety. Ensure you have a readily available fire extinguisher, and be mindful of any potential fire hazards. Never leave your barbecue unattended. Inform someone of your plans, including your chosen location and expected return time.
Weather Conditions: Check the weather forecast before heading out. Windy conditions can make controlling a fire difficult, while rain can completely wash out your plans. Be prepared for temperature changes as the night progresses.
Bug Spray and Lighting: Mosquitoes and other insects can be a nuisance at night. Pack insect repellent and adequate lighting, such as lanterns or portable LED lights.
Trash Disposal: Practice Leave No Trace principles. Pack out everything you pack in, including leftover food, charcoal, and trash.
Permits and Regulations: Before heading to your chosen location, research local regulations regarding open fires and barbecue permits. Some areas may have restrictions, especially during dry seasons or periods of high fire risk.
